Job Outline
Duties
4. Maintenance of the Quality Management System (QMS) and the use of its associated software (Pragma and Adhoc)
5. Review of manufacturing and cleaning records
6. Review of shipment documentation and containers prior to release
7. Issuance of materials to production
8. Performance of the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) Walkthroughs as scheduled
9. Provision of proactive reporting, investigation and response to quality related issues
10. Liaison with the Quality Assurance Assistant Manager on matters such as those related to the QMS, audits, documentation, etc
11. Preparation of quality documentation such as product quality reviews
12. Performance of cleaning visual inspections
13. Provision of training to others as required
14. Provision of assistance with audit preparation and the performance of internal audits as required
15. Provision support to other departments for quality related issues and to the Quality Assurance Assistant Manager to ensure site adherence to current GMP
16. Perform other duties as assigned by their supervisor (or designee in their absence)
Responsibilities
17. To adhere to cGMP and EHS practices at all times
18. To liaise with supervisors to ensure the rapid communication of issues and the progression of projects, material release, etc.
19. To ensure the QMS is maintained as per cGMP including but not limited to change controls, deviations, corrective and preventative actions, controlled documentation, etc.
20. To prepare quality documentation including but not limited to product quality reviews, quality risk assessments, etc. To critically review and approve updated documentation as required
21. To critically review manufacturing, cleaning and shipment documentation to ensure their adherence to cGlv1P and to address any outstanding issue prior to release
22. To ensure that all material meets the relevant requirements, and all issues are resolved prior to approval and release
23. To support the Quality Assurance Assistant Manager with audit preparation and to participate in audits To assist other department members issues as required
24. To assist with periodic reviews of the QMS and its communication to site management and the Corporate Quality
Assurance and Regulatory Affairs Director
25. To have a general interest in quality assurance activities and the desire for improvement opportunities

Working Conditions
This position is primarily an office-based role in the Quality Assurance with some duties performed within the GVW areas such as production, quality control and the warehouses
The company will provide workplace conditions in which its personnel can function safely and efficiently. All personnel are required to comply with current standard operating procedures and cGMP as required.
Work Performance
The employee's performance will be monitored by the Quality Assurance Assistant Manager and will be assessed as per the following criteria:
27. General timekeeping and attendance
28. Work output
29. Quality of workmanship
30. Compliance with agreed work schedule and programme
31. Compliance with Health, Safety and Environmental and Quality practices
32. Ability to work in a team environment
33. Ability to work independently
34. Work attitude
35. Training and self-development
36. Contribution to improving the department
37. Overall team performance
